Three innovative products of BASF won the European BSB Award
BASF Care Creations® has won three European BSB Innovation Awards in 2020, including: EcoSun Pass is a new method for evaluating the environmental friendliness index of UV filter systems, and won the championship in the "concept" category. BASF's anionic surfactant Texapon® SFA is 100% natural and won the second place in the category of "functional ingredients" in the cosmetics category. BASF's active ingredient Inolixir ™ is a 100% bioactive ingredient extracted from Chaga, ranking third in the “Natural and Active Ingredients” sub-category of cosmetics.

BASF award-winning products
EcoSun Pass is a new environmental protection evaluation method developed specifically for sunscreen products, used to evaluate the environmental compatibility of UV filter systems in sunscreen products. This method supports the transparent evaluation of UV filters based on internationally recognized standards. The evaluation items include eight different parameters, ranging from biodegradability, aquatic toxicity to potential endocrine disruption. This method can not only evaluate the impact of various ultraviolet filters on the environment, but also evaluate the environmental compatibility of sunscreen filter combinations from different suppliers in sunscreen products.
Texapon SFA® is a very mild and innovative anionic surfactant derived from sustainable renewable resources certified by the Sustainable Palm Oil Roundtable Initiative (RSPO). This product is very gentle on the skin and eyes, especially suitable for delicate baby skin and tear-free shampoo products. Clinical trials have shown that the formula containing Texapon SFA® does not cause a burning sensation in the eyes, and it is very gentle on the skin and mucous membranes. Consumer sensory testing verified that Texapon SFA® can bring a dense, stable creamy foam. The product is 100% biodegradable and can replace sulfate surfactants. In addition, the product can also enhance the hair conditioning effect of cationic polymers in shampoo products. It has been proven by relevant tests to make hair smoother and easier to comb, and it can also achieve the same effect in shampoo products without cationic polymers .
Inolixir ™ is a highly concentrated active ingredient derived from wild Chaga in the birch forest of northern Canada. It is extracted with an innovative green technology-subcritical water technology (that is, using high-pressure hot water heated to 100-374 ° C instead of organic solvents) It has all the nutrients and natural characteristics of wild Chaga. By enhancing the skin barrier function and its microcirculation, Inolixir ™ can protect natural skin in all directions, make the skin healthy as before, and significantly improve fine lines, dark circles and redness of the skin. Inolixir ™ is a cosmeceutical solution specially developed for sensitive skin. At the same time, it can effectively relieve tired skin and significantly improve dull skin.
The German cosmetics consultancy BSB has established the Cosmetics Innovation Award since 2003. It selects the most innovative products for commendation for different categories of finished products and raw materials in the cosmetics industry. To date, BASF has won 16 BSB awards for its personal care product solutions.
